1. Decode Energy Ratings and Prioritise Efficiency
The first crucial step in selecting an air conditioning system for Perth’s demanding climate is to understand and prioritise energy efficiency. Air conditioning is a significant contributor to household energy consumption, especially during prolonged heatwaves. Therefore, a higher energy-rated unit can translate into substantial long-term savings on your electricity bills. Look for the Australian Energy Rating Label on any unit you consider. This label provides two key metrics:
- EER (Energy Efficiency Ratio) for Cooling: This indicates how efficiently the unit cools. A higher EER means better cooling efficiency.
- COP (Coefficient of Performance) for Heating: As most modern systems are reverse cycle, they also provide heating. A higher COP signifies better heating efficiency.
The star rating system, displayed prominently on the label, offers an easy-to-understand visual guide. More stars mean greater energy efficiency. While a unit with more stars might have a slightly higher upfront cost, the savings on your energy bills over its lifespan, particularly in Perth where air conditioning is used extensively, will often far outweigh the initial investment. Beyond the star rating, consider systems with inverter technology. Unlike older, conventional units that cycle on and off at full power, inverter air conditioners adjust their compressor speed to precisely match the cooling or heating demand. This constant, modulated operation is far more energy-efficient, quieter, and provides more consistent temperatures. For Perth’s variable temperatures, an inverter system can efficiently handle both extreme heat and milder conditions without wasting energy. Furthermore, if considering a ducted system, inquire about zoned capabilities. Zoning allows you to cool or heat only the areas of your home that are in use, rather than the entire house. This targeted approach can drastically reduce energy waste and is a highly recommended feature for larger Perth homes, offering unparalleled comfort and efficiency.
2. Choose the Right AC Type for Your Perth Home
Perth homes come in various shapes and sizes, from compact apartments to sprawling family residences. Matching the air conditioning system type to your home’s layout, your cooling/heating needs, and your budget is paramount. The primary types available are split systems, ducted systems, and evaporative coolers.
Split Systems: Targeted Comfort
Split systems consist of an indoor unit (mounted on a wall) and an outdoor compressor unit.
- Pros:
- Cost-effective for cooling or heating single rooms or open-plan areas.
- Relatively easy and quick to install.
- Can be installed in apartments or smaller homes where a ducted system isn’t feasible.
- Modern units are very energy-efficient and quiet.
- Cons:
- Only provides comfort to the specific area where it’s installed.
- Multiple units are needed to cool an entire house, which can impact aesthetics and overall cost.
Perth Relevance: Ideal for bedrooms, living rooms, or home offices where individual climate control is desired. They are a popular choice for renters or those on a tighter budget looking to cool specific hotspots.
Ducted Systems: Whole-Home Climate Control
Ducted air conditioning provides seamless, whole-home heating and cooling from a single outdoor unit connected to an indoor unit, typically located in the roof space. Conditioned air is distributed via a network of ducts to outlets in various rooms.
- Pros:
- Provides consistent and even temperature control throughout the entire home.
- Aesthetically pleasing, with only discreet grilles visible.
- Offers zoning capabilities (as discussed above), allowing you to control different areas independently.
- Adds value to your property.
- Cons:
- Higher upfront cost for installation.
- More complex installation, often requiring significant roof space.
- Can be less energy-efficient if not properly zoned and used.
Perth Relevance: The preferred choice for larger family homes or new builds in Perth, offering superior comfort and convenience, especially during extended periods of extreme heat or cold.
Evaporative Coolers: The Eco-Friendly Perth Option
Evaporative cooling works by drawing hot, dry air over water-saturated pads, which cools the air through evaporation. This cooled, moistened air is then circulated throughout the home.
- Pros:
- Significantly more energy-efficient than refrigerative air conditioning, resulting in much lower running costs.
- Introduces fresh, filtered air into the home, rather than recirculating stale air.
- Operates with windows and doors slightly open, which many people prefer.
- Ideal for Perth’s typically dry climate, as it adds beneficial moisture to the air.
- Lower upfront cost compared to ducted refrigerative systems.
- Cons:
- Not effective in high humidity conditions (though rare, Perth can experience humid days).
- Does not provide heating.
- Requires a consistent water supply.
- Can feel less “cold” than refrigerative systems, offering more of a refreshing breeze.
Perth Relevance: A highly viable and environmentally conscious option for many Perth homeowners, especially those who appreciate fresh air and lower energy bills. It excels during the vast majority of Perth’s dry summer days but may struggle during the occasional humid spell. Many Perth residents combine evaporative cooling with a smaller reverse cycle split system for targeted heating or cooling on very humid days. Remember that most modern split and ducted refrigerative systems are reverse cycle, meaning they provide both heating and cooling. Given Perth’s surprisingly cold winters, a reverse cycle system is a highly recommended investment for year-round comfort.
3. Size Your System Correctly for Perth’s Climate
One of the most critical factors often overlooked is correctly sizing your air conditioning system. The “kW” (kilowatt) capacity indicates the system’s cooling and heating power. An incorrectly sized unit will either struggle to cool your home or waste energy, leading to discomfort and higher bills.
Consequences of Incorrect Sizing:
- System is Too Small:
- Will run constantly at maximum capacity, struggling to reach the desired temperature.
- Inefficient operation, leading to higher energy consumption and premature wear.
- Won’t provide adequate comfort during peak Perth summer temperatures.
- System is Too Large:
- Will “short cycle” – turning on and off frequently without running long enough to effectively dehumidify the air.
- Can lead to a clammy, uncomfortable feeling even if the temperature is cool.
- Higher upfront cost for unnecessary capacity.
- Less efficient operation due to constant stopping and starting.
Factors Influencing Correct Sizing:
A professional air conditioning specialist will conduct a thorough assessment, taking into account several factors specific to your Perth home:
- Room Size and Layout: The primary determinant, measured in square meters or cubic meters (length x width x ceiling height).
- Insulation Quality: Well-insulated walls and ceilings significantly reduce heat gain and loss, requiring less cooling/heating power.
- Window Types and Orientation: Large, single-glazed windows, especially those facing north or west, allow considerable heat transfer. Double glazing or effective window treatments can reduce this.
- Ceiling Height: Higher ceilings mean a larger volume of air to condition.
- Number of Occupants: People generate body heat.
- Internal Heat Sources: Appliances (refrigerators, ovens), lighting (especially older incandescent bulbs), and electronic devices contribute to the internal heat load.
- Perth’s Climate Data: The system needs to be powerful enough to cope with Perth’s peak summer temperatures, which can often exceed 40°C.
- Shading: External shading from eaves, pergolas, or trees can significantly reduce solar heat gain.
Recommendation: Never guess the size you need. Always insist on a qualified professional conducting a detailed site assessment to accurately calculate the required kW capacity for your specific home and needs. They use industry-standard calculations to ensure optimal performance and efficiency.
4. Strategic Installation and Placement are Key
Even the most energy-efficient and perfectly sized air conditioning unit can underperform if not installed correctly. Professional installation is not just about getting the unit running; it’s about optimising its performance, longevity, and safety.
Indoor Unit Placement (Split Systems):
- Optimal Airflow: Position the unit to allow for unobstructed airflow across the room, avoiding areas where furniture might block the air path.
- Away from Heat Sources: Avoid placing it near direct sunlight, lamps, or other heat-generating appliances, as this can confuse the thermostat.
- Structural Integrity: Ensure the wall can support the unit’s weight and that drainage can be properly managed.
Outdoor Unit Placement (All Refrigerative Systems):
- Shade and Airflow: Ideally, the outdoor unit should be placed in a shaded area to prevent it from overheating, which improves efficiency. Ensure there’s ample space around it for proper airflow.
- Noise Consideration: Place it away from bedrooms or quiet living areas to minimise noise disturbance. Modern units are quieter, but noise can still be a factor.
- Stable Base: The unit must be installed on a stable, level surface to prevent vibrations and ensure proper operation.
- Accessibility: Allow easy access for future maintenance and servicing.
Ductwork Design and Installation (Ducted Systems):
- Insulation: All ducting should be properly insulated to prevent energy loss as air travels from the indoor unit to the outlets.
- Minimal Bends: Excessive bends or kinks in the ductwork restrict airflow, reducing efficiency and increasing strain on the system.
- Correct Sizing: Ducts must be correctly sized to deliver the appropriate amount of air to each zone or room.
Professional Installation is Non-Negotiable: Only use licensed and experienced air conditioning installers. Incorrect installation can lead to:
- Reduced efficiency and higher energy bills.
- Premature breakdowns and costly repairs.
- Voided manufacturer warranties.
- Safety hazards, particularly with electrical and refrigerant connections.
A reputable Perth installer will conduct a site visit, plan the optimal placement of both indoor and outdoor units, and ensure all electrical and refrigerant lines are safely and correctly connected according to Australian standards.
5. Explore Smart Features and Advanced Controls
Modern air conditioning systems offer a host of smart features that can significantly enhance comfort, convenience, and energy efficiency, making them particularly appealing for tech-savvy Perth homeowners.
- Wi-Fi Connectivity and Smart Home Integration: Many units now come with Wi-Fi modules, allowing you to control your AC remotely via a smartphone app. Imagine turning on your air conditioning on your drive home from work, ensuring your house is cool and comfortable the moment you step inside after a scorching Perth day. Some systems can also integrate with broader smart home ecosystems (e.g., Google Home, Amazon Alexa) for voice control and automation.
- Zoning Capabilities: As mentioned, for ducted systems, zoning is a game-changer. It allows you to create different temperature zones within your home, cooling only the occupied areas. This is incredibly efficient for Perth families whose living patterns change throughout the day.
- Programmable Timers and Sleep Modes: Set your AC to turn on or off at specific times, or to adjust temperatures during the night for optimal sleep comfort and energy saving. Sleep modes often gradually increase the temperature slightly overnight, saving energy without compromising comfort.
- Motion Sensors and Presence Detection: Some advanced units include sensors that detect human presence. If a room is empty for a certain period, the system can automatically switch to an energy-saving mode or turn off, resuming operation when someone returns.
- Humidity Control: While Perth’s climate is generally dry, occasional humid days can occur. Systems with advanced humidity control can help maintain a comfortable indoor environment by extracting excess moisture, even if the temperature setting remains constant.
- Air Purification and Filtration: For allergy sufferers or those concerned about indoor air quality, look for units with advanced filtration systems that can capture dust, pollen, allergens, and even some viruses and bacteria. This is particularly beneficial during Perth’s dusty periods or bushfire season.
These smart features move air conditioning beyond simple temperature control, offering a truly integrated and intelligent climate management solution for your Perth home.
6. Understand Warranty, Maintenance, and After-Sales Support
Investing in an air conditioning system is a long-term commitment, so understanding the warranty, the importance of regular maintenance, and the availability of after-sales support is crucial.
Warranty:
- Length and Coverage: Most reputable brands offer a 5-year warranty on parts and labour. Understand what is covered and for how long.
- Installation Warranty: Ensure your installer also provides a warranty on their workmanship.
- Voiding Conditions: Be aware that DIY repairs or using unlicensed technicians can void your warranty.
- Local Support: Choose brands that have a strong presence and authorised service agents in Perth. This ensures easier access to spare parts and qualified technicians should issues arise.
Regular Maintenance:
Air conditioning systems, like cars, require regular servicing to operate efficiently and extend their lifespan.
- User Maintenance: Regularly clean or replace your unit’s filters as per the manufacturer’s instructions. Dirty filters restrict airflow, reduce efficiency, and can impact air quality.
- Professional Servicing: Schedule professional air conditioning service Perth typically once every 12-24 months. A qualified technician will:
- Check refrigerant levels and connections.
- Clean coils and components.
- Inspect electrical connections.
- Check for leaks and blockages.
- Test overall system performance.
Benefits of Maintenance: Regular servicing maintains efficiency, reduces energy bills, prevents minor issues from becoming major breakdowns, and prolongs the life of your unit – all vital for enduring Perth’s climate.
After-Sales Support:
Choose an installer or supplier who offers reliable after-sales support. This includes being available for warranty claims, routine servicing, and emergency air conditioning repairs Perth. A company with a strong local reputation in Perth is usually a good indicator of reliable support.
7. Get Multiple Quotes and Vet Your Installer
Finally, once you have a good understanding of your needs and the types of systems available, the last step is to get multiple quotes and thoroughly vet your chosen installer.
Comparing Quotes:
Don’t just look at the bottom line. When comparing quotes, ensure they include:
- System Specifications: The exact make, model, and kW capacity of the unit(s).
- Installation Details: A clear breakdown of what the installation involves (e.g., electrical work, pipe length, ducting, outdoor unit base).
- Warranty Information: Both manufacturer and installer warranties.
- Inclusions/Exclusions: What’s covered and what might be an extra cost (e.g., removal of old unit, specific electrical upgrades).
- Energy Efficiency Ratings: Confirm the star ratings of the proposed systems.
A reputable installer will always conduct a thorough site visit to assess your home’s unique requirements before providing a quote. Be wary of installers who offer a quote over the phone without seeing your property.
Vetting Your Installer:
This is perhaps the most crucial step. A poor installation can negate all the benefits of a good quality unit.
- ARC Tick Certification: Ensure the installer holds an ARC Tick licence (Australian Refrigeration Council). This verifies they are legally qualified to handle refrigerants.
- Electrical Contractor License: All electrical work must be carried out by a licensed electrician.
- Insurance: Verify they have public liability insurance.
- References and Reviews: Ask for references or check online reviews (Google, ProductReview, local community groups) to gauge their reputation and customer satisfaction.
- Experience: Inquire about their experience with specific brands and types of systems, particularly in Perth’s climate.
- Clear Communication: Choose an installer who communicates clearly, answers all your questions, and provides detailed, transparent quotes.
